Output ed5677c86c6354c9e8d511fff3115d64c3aaccdef5c3468bacf399ead1616542:63

value
9582990
script pubkey
OP_0 OP_PUSHBYTES_20 cf7bb2095c9eafc4ec95ea7f6b458b7604ff89a8
address
bc1qeaamyz2un6hufmy4aflkk3vtwcz0lzdg3pv8yg
transaction
ed5677c86c6354c9e8d511fff3115d64c3aaccdef5c3468bacf399ead1616542